Ingredients for Mediterranean Chicken with Tomatoes and Olives:
For a delightful Mediterranean experience, gather the following ingredients to create your irresistibly delicious Mediterranean Chicken with Tomatoes and Olives:
– 4 boneless, skinless chicken breasts
– 2 tablespoons minced garlic or garlic paste
– Kosher salt, to taste
– Black pepper, to taste
– 1 tablespoon dried oregano, divided
– 2 tablespoons extra virgin olive oil
– 1/2 cup dry white wine
– Juice from 1 large lemon
– 1/2 cup chicken broth
– 1 medium red onion, finely chopped
– 4 small tomatoes (about 1 1/2 cups), diced
– 1/4 cup sliced green olives
– A handful of fresh parsley, stems removed, leaves chopped
– Crumbled feta cheese (optional)

Instructions
- Prep the chicken: Pat the chicken breasts dry. Make three shallow slits on each side of the chicken breast.
- Season the chicken: Rub the garlic on both sides of the chicken, pushing some garlic into the slits you made. Season the chicken breasts on both sides with salt, pepper and 1/2 of the dried oregano.
- Sear the chicken: In a large cast iron skillet, heat the olive oil on medium-high. Sear the chicken on both sides, then add the white wine and reduce by half.
- Braise the chicken: Add the lemon juice and chicken broth. Sprinkle the remaining 1/2 tablespoon of oregano on top and turn the heat to medium. Cover with a lid or tightly with foil. Cook for about 5 to 6 minutes on one side, then turn the chicken over and cook for 5 to 6 additional minutes, or until the internal temperature of the chicken reaches 165°F.
- Finish the chicken and serve: Uncover and top with chopped onions, tomatoes and olives. Cover again and cook for 3 minutes. Finish with the parsley and feta cheese (if using). Enjoy!
Notes
Pro-Tip: If you’re working with larger and thicker boneless chicken breasts, you might want to split them into cutlets. This dish can be tweaked by adding spinach or switching olives for capers.
